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

El desarrollo de un pensamiento lógico y algorítmico


Enviado por   •  11 de Mayo de 2015  •  Trabajo  •  1.024 Palabras (5 Páginas)  •  394 Visitas

Página 1 de 5

INTRODUCCION

-En particular, el desarrollo y aplicación del pensamiento algorítmico es esencial para la formación de especialistas de la informática y computación donde se presentan soluciones algorítmicas, usualmente, para el tratamiento de información. Soluciones que se representan mediante la utilización de lenguajes de programación, para cuyo uso se requiere el dominio de la sintaxis y semántica de dichos lenguajes.

-Desarrollar el razonamiento lógico y algorítmico permite analizar problemas y entregar soluciones algorítmicas, no sólo para sistemas computacionales. Por ejemplo, es común que en la vida diaria, se presenten situaciones tales como cocinar, realizar alguna acción en el trabajo, en la casa, etc.

LENGUAJE DE PROGRAMACION SCRATCH

-Los niños de todo el mundo pueden compartir ahora proyectos de Scratch con los demás, en donde cada uno puede ver los bloques de programación de Scratch en su propio idioma .

-Para que Scratch tenga éxito, el lenguaje está vinculado a una comunidad donde la gente puede apoyar, colaborar y criticar unos a otros y construir sobre el trabajo de los otros.

HIPOTESIS

Dado que este trabajo esta enfocado al uso de la aplicación de la herramienta Scratch, no se utilizan metodologias clasicas usalmente usadas para el desarrollo de producto de software.

PENSAMIENTO ALGORITMICO

-Esta capacidad para analizar y dar solución a problemas es una habilidad importante para todo ser humano, y en especial para los estudiantes.

-Se denomina algoritmo a un grupo finito de operaciones organizada de manera lógica y ordenada que permite solucionar un determinado problema. Se trata de una serie de instrucciones o reglas establecidas que, por medio de una sucesión de pasos, permiten arribar a un resultado o solución.

- El pensamiento algorítmico ayuda a los estudiantes a pasar del problema a su solución algorítmica. Esto implica la capacidad de definir y enunciar con claridad un problema; descomponerlo en subproblemas más pequeños y manejables; y, describir una solución en un conjunto de pasos bien definido.

- El problema está que en los niños de educación básica, trabajar y desarrollar el pensar algorítmicamente puede ser muy complicado ya que la sintaxis y semántica de las herramientas a utilizar para dicho propósito no es fácil de comprender para niños. Como se mencionó previamente, el lenguaje de programación animada Scratch es muy buena herramienta para introducir a los niños de una forma más fácil y adecuada en el desarrollo del pensamiento lógico y algorítmico.

-No existe un método universal que permita resolver cualquier tipo de problema algorítmico [17]. En general, la solución de problemas es un proceso creativo donde el conocimiento, la habilidad y la experiencia tienen un papel importante.

- Para abordar y dar solución a problemas algorítmicos, es necesario tener en cuenta que, para la mayoría de ellos, hay muchas maneras de resolverlos y pueden existir muchas soluciones. Sin embargo, existen herramientas que ayudan a diseñar la solucion a problemas algorítmicos ; para esto tenemos los diagramas de flujo y pseudocódigo.

PSEUDOCODIGO

El principal objetivo del pseudocódigo es el de representar

...

Descargar como (para miembros actualizados) txt (6 Kb)
Leer 4 páginas más »
Disponible sólo en Clubensayos.com